How might data be collected for this target response?Direct Observation: Monitor counselors during shifts to observe the implementation of antecedent interventions. Checklists: Use daily checklists for counselors to document the use of antecedent interventions and any barriers encountered. Incident Logs: Maintain logs of stress management incidents, noting the use of antecedent interventions and their effectiveness. Staff Surveys: Conduct surveys to gather feedback from counselors on the clarity and feasibility of antecedent intervention procedures. Video Review: Record sessions and review them to assess the consistency and accuracy of antecedent intervention implementation.
Identify an intervention, or set of interventions, based on the PDC-HS data.

Task Clarification: Provide clear, step-by-step instructions and visual aids to help counselors understand and implement antecedent interventions correctly.
Prompting: Use verbal and visual prompts to remind counselors to implement antecedent interventions at the appropriate times.
Training Sessions: Conduct regular training sessions to reinforce the importance and proper use of antecedent interventions.
Performance Feedback: Implement a structured feedback system to provide counselors with immediate and constructive feedback on their performance.
